Common Ghost Controls Gate Repair Problems We Solve in Port Orchard

  • TSS1 circuit board corrosion from salt air. Port Orchard’s marine climate delivers over 50 inches of annual rainfall laced with salt off Sinclair Inlet. Standard zinc-plated terminals on TSS1 battery backups and control boards corrode visibly within a single season along Bay Street and Beach Drive. We replace with sealed OEM boards and marine-grade stainless hardware — not as an upsell, but as the baseline that prevents a callback next November.
  • TSS2 swing arm binding on rotted cedar posts. The 98366 corridor is packed with 1960s–1990s homes whose original cedar posts were set in concrete collars. These trap moisture against the wood; the post looks sound above ground but fails the operator’s torque test entirely. We replace with steel posts on gravel-drained footers and remount with stainless brackets.
  • MLS1 slide motor failure from track debris and moisture. Long rural driveways in 98367’s South Kitsap parcels collect leaves, gravel runoff, and standing water in slide tracks. The MLS1 motor wasn’t designed to push through that resistance indefinitely. We clean, realign, and seal — or replace the motor if the windings are already compromised.
  • Keypad membrane infiltration from salt spray. Every replacement keypad we install in shoreline Port Orchard properties gets a weatherproof shroud. The membrane failures happen faster here than anywhere else we work in Kitsap County; it’s not a defect, it’s the environment.
  • Battery backup premature failure in unsealed housings. Ghost Controls battery compartments without proper gasket seals absorb coastal moisture and sulfate early. We stock sealed replacement housings and relocate batteries above grade when the original install was too close to the ground line.

Ghost Controls Service in Port Orchard: What Local Conditions Mean for Your Equipment

Port Orchard sits directly on Sinclair Inlet, and that proximity creates a repair environment you won’t find in Silverdale or Ghost Controls repair in Bremerton. The 98366 zip code has a unique concentration of 1960s–1990s homes with original cedar gate posts set in concrete collars — these trap moisture against the wood, causing rot that isn’t visible above ground until a Ghost Controls operator mount torque test fails the post entirely. We’ve learned to probe every post in this corridor before quoting a control board replacement; the number of “dead operator” calls that turned out to be structural rot would surprise you if you hadn’t been doing this fourteen years.

On a December call in the 98366 corridor off Bay Street, we found Ghost Controls in East Port Orchard with a TSS1 operator that had stopped mid-cycle. The post — a 4×4 cedar set in a concrete collar — was rotted 8 inches below grade but looked sound above. We replaced the post with a marine-grade steel post set on a gravel-drained concrete footer, remounted the TSS1 with stainless brackets, and installed a sealed battery backup. The gate hasn’t ghosted since.

Meanwhile, the sprawling acreage parcels in 98367’s South Kitsap area mean long-driveway automatic gates are unusually prevalent here. MLS1 slide operators on these properties face accumulated debris, seasonal heave from saturated soils, and the simple mechanical wear of opening cycles measured in hundreds of feet rather than dozens. Ghost Controls Service Pricing in Port Orchard

Most Ghost Controls repairs in Port Orchard fall between $180 and $420, with the final cost hinging on three factors: whether the problem is electrical (board, sensor, keypad), mechanical (motor, arm, track), or structural (post, hinge, weld). Diagnostic calls start with a free estimate — David shows up, identifies the failure mode, and quotes before any work begins.

  • Keypad or sensor replacement: $180–$260
  • TSS1/TSS2 control board replacement (OEM): $280–$380
  • MLS1 motor repair or replacement: $320–$420
  • Post replacement with marine-grade steel and stainless hardware: $340–$520
  • Rust treatment and hardware upgrade (marine-grade conversion): $220–$340

Structural post repairs in the 98366 corridor often land at the higher end — the concrete collar removal and footer drainage add labor that a simple board swap doesn’t.
